Analysis
Saint Vincent and the Grenadines recorded 3.6% for adolescents out of school in 2020.
That represents a change of up 90.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, adolescents out of school in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ines peaked at 5.5% in 2008 and was at its lowest, 0.6%, in 2004.
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ranks 109th of 179 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Adolescents out of school in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, year by year
| Year | % of lower secondary school age |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 4.6% | — |
| 2002 | 3.3% | -29.1% |
| 2003 | 3.4% | +3.4% |
| 2004 | 0.6% | -82.4% |
| 2007 | 5.0% | +727.4% |
| 2008 | 5.5% | +10.6% |
| 2009 | 4.5% | -17.1% |
| 2010 | 1.9% | -58.7% |
| 2013 | 1.1% | -41.2% |
| 2014 | 0.7% | -37.4% |
| 2015 | 1.1% | +57.1% |
| 2020 | 3.6% | +228.8% |
Saint Vincent and the Grenadines compared with similar countries
- Saint Vincent and the Grenadines's 3.6% is below the median for upper middle income countries, which is 7.5%, 48% of the median. (53 countries reporting)
- Saint Vincent and the Grenadines's 3.6% is below the median for Latin America & Caribbean, which is 7.7%, 46% of the median. (37 countries reporting)
